About Mediapolis High School

Set in Mediapolis, Iowa, Mediapolis High School is a close-knit four-year high school, operated by Mediapolis Comm School District. It caters to 312 students across grades 9 through 12. By comparison, Iowa's public schools average about 468 students each, so Mediapolis High School sits 33% leaner than that benchmark.

Mediapolis High School is one of 3 schools operated by Mediapolis Comm School District, a district that educates 966 students overall.

Looking at the student body, Mediapolis High School lists that nearly all students (94%) are White. Other groups include 3% multiracial, 2% Hispanic. By comparison, Des Moines County as a whole is about 86% White, so the school skews meaningfully more White than its surroundings.

On the income-and-resources front, On paper, Mediapolis High School has 25 full-time-equivalent teachers, translating to a class-load average of around 12.3:1. That figure is tighter than the state norm's 17.3:1 average. About 27% of enrolled students meet the income threshold for free or reduced-price lunch,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ator. That share is south of Des Moines County's rate of about 45%.

With demographic context factored in, Mediapolis High School s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 78.5%; this one delivers 80.7%.

Zooming out to the county, census data for Des Moines County shows median household earnings sit near $62,928, roughly 24%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and the poverty rate sits near 10%. Across Des Moines County's 15 public schools (combined enrollment of about 5,632 students), Mediapolis High School is one campus in the mix.

The closest other public school is Mediapolis Middle School, roughly 0.0 miles away. 2 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ius. Among the 9 schools in that immediate cluster with test data (this one included), Mediapolis High School ranks 3rd on composite proficiency, above the local average of 70.8%.
